The Foundation: Understanding hCG and Its Role
Before we delve into the world of ultra-sensitive tests, it's crucial to understand the star of the show: human Chorionic Gonadotropin, or hCG. This hormone is the definitive biological signal of pregnancy.
Shortly after a fertilized egg implants into the uterine lining—a process that typically occurs 6 to 12 days after ovulation—the developing placenta begins to produce hCG. This hormone's primary job is to signal the corpus luteum (the remnant of the ovarian follicle that released the egg) to continue producing progesterone. Progesterone is essential for maintaining the uterine lining and supporting the early pregnancy.
The hCG Timeline: A Rapid Rise
hCG doesn't just appear; it multiplies at a staggering rate in early pregnancy, typically doubling approximately every 48 to 72 hours. This exponential growth is what makes early detection possible.
- Implantation (Around 6-12 DPO): hCG production begins, but levels are minuscule, often below 5 mIU/mL.
- 10-12 DPO: Levels can reach between 10 and 50 mIU/mL, now potentially within the range of the most sensitive tests.
- 14 DPO (Around the time of a missed period): Levels often surpass 50 mIU/mL, solidly within the detection range of most standard tests.
- Weeks 4-12 of Pregnancy: hCG levels continue their rapid climb, peaking towards the end of the first trimester before gradually declining and plateauing for the remainder of the pregnancy.
This timeline is the key. A test that can detect a lower concentration of hCG can, theoretically, provide a positive result earlier in this timeline.
Decoding Sensitivity: What "Lowest hCG Detection" Really Means
The term "sensitivity" is the heart of the matter. In the context of pregnancy tests, sensitivity refers to the minimum concentration of hCG in the urine required for the test to return a positive result. This is measured in milli-International Units per milliliter (mIU/mL).
The lower the mIU/mL number, the higher the sensitivity of the test. A test with a sensitivity of 10 mIU/mL is more sensitive and can detect lower levels of hCG than a test with a sensitivity of 25 mIU/mL.
The Sensitivity Spectrum
- Standard Sensitivity (20-25 mIU/mL): These are common tests found on most store shelves. They are highly accurate from the day of your expected period onwards.
- High Sensitivity (15-20 mIU/mL): These tests can often detect pregnancy a few days before a missed period.
- Ultra-High Sensitivity (10-12 mIU/mL and below): This category represents the "lowest hCG detection" tests. They are engineered to identify the very earliest traces of hCG, potentially providing results up to 5-6 days before a missed period.
It's important to note that a test's claimed sensitivity is determined under ideal laboratory conditions. Real-world factors like urine concentration, time of day, and individual hCG production rates can affect the actual result.
The Science Behind the Strip: How Tests Achieve High Sensitivity
Modern pregnancy tests are technological marvels of lateral flow immunoassay technology. The core principle involves antibodies designed to bind specifically to the hCG hormone.
- The Sample Pad: You apply urine to this area. The urine begins to wick across the test strip.
- The Conjugate Pad: This section contains mobile antibodies that are specific to hCG. These antibodies are also attached to colorful particles (often gold nanoparticles or blue latex beads). If hCG is present in the urine, it binds to these mobile antibodies, forming a complex.
- The Test Line (T Line): Further along the strip is the test line. This area is coated with fixed antibodies that are also specific to hCG, but they bind to a different site on the hCG molecule. As the urine mixture passes over this line, the hCG-antibody-color complex gets captured. The accumulation of these colorful complexes creates the visible line.
- The Control Line (C Line): This line is coated with antibodies that catch the free mobile antibodies, regardless of whether hCG is present. Its purpose is to confirm that the test is functioning correctly and that urine has flowed across the entire strip.
To achieve a lower detection threshold, manufacturers refine this process. They might use:
- More Potent Antibodies: Developing antibodies with a higher affinity for hCG, meaning they bind to it more readily and strongly, even at very low concentrations.
- Advanced Signal Amplification: Enhancing the visibility of the color reaction. For instance, using more reactive nanoparticles or enzymatic reactions that amplify the signal, making a faint line more detectable.
- Optimized Membrane Flow: Precisely engineering the nitrocellulose membrane to ensure a consistent and optimal flow rate, allowing maximum time for the antibody-hCG binding reaction to occur.
This intricate dance of chemistry and biology is what allows a test to detect a concentration as low as 10 mIU/mL—a truly minuscule amount—and announce a life-changing result.
The Double-Edged Sword: The Pros and Cons of Early Testing
Testing early with a high-sensitivity test is tempting, but it comes with its own set of considerations.
The Advantages
- Earlier Peace of Mind: For those trying to conceive, an early positive can bring immense joy and allow for earlier prenatal planning, including starting prenatal vitamins and adjusting lifestyle habits.
- More Time for Decisions: In any circumstance, having more information earlier can provide valuable time for making informed decisions and seeking medical advice.
- Reduced Anxiety: For some, the agony of the "two-week wait" is alleviated by being able to test sooner.
The Challenges and Limitations
- Risk of Chemical Pregnancy: The most significant caveat of early testing is the increased likelihood of detecting a chemical pregnancy. This is a very early miscarriage that occurs shortly after implantation, often before or around the time of an expected period. In a cycle without an early test, a person might simply experience a slightly late or normal period and never know they were briefly pregnant. An ultra-sensitive test will detect the initial rise of hCG, but if the pregnancy is not viable, levels will soon fall, leading to a negative test or a period after a positive test. This can be an emotionally devastating experience.
- False Negatives:
Even the most sensitive test can return a negative result if testing is done too early. If implantation hasn't occurred yet, or if hCG levels are still below the test's detection threshold, the result will be negative. This is not a test error; it's a biological timing issue. A negative result before a missed period should always be followed up with another test if your period does not arrive.
- User Error and Evaporation Lines: The intense scrutiny of an early test can lead to misinterpretation. Straining to see a line might cause someone to see an "evaporation line"—a faint, colorless mark left by evaporated urine—as a positive. Always read the results within the exact time window specified in the instructions (usually 3-5 minutes).
- Variable hCG Production: Not every body is the same. The rate of hCG production can vary from person to person and pregnancy to pregnancy. One individual might have a blazing positive at 9 DPO, while another with a perfectly healthy pregnancy might not have enough hCG for a test to detect until 14 DPO.
Maximizing Accuracy: How to Get the Most Reliable Result
If you choose to use a high-sensitivity test, you can take steps to improve the reliability of your result.
- Test with First-Morning Urine: This is the golden rule of early testing. Your urine is most concentrated after several hours of sleep, meaning it will contain the highest possible concentration of hCG. This gives you the best shot at detection.
- Don't Drink Excessive Fluids Before Testing: While it's important to stay hydrated, drinking a large amount of water right before a test can dilute your urine and artificially lower the concentration of hCG, potentially leading to a false negative.
- Read the Instructions Meticulously: Every test is different. Follow the instructions for how long to hold the test in the stream, how long to wait for results, and how to interpret those results. Setting a timer is highly recommended.
- Consider Testing Serially: If you test early and get a negative, but your period still hasn't arrived, test again in 48 hours. The doubling time of hCG means that a previously undetectable level could become clearly positive in just two days.
- Understand What a Positive Looks Like: Any line with color, no matter how faint, that appears within the test timeframe is considered a positive result. The line's darkness is not a measure of the strength of the pregnancy, only of the current concentration of hCG.
Beyond the Test: The Next Steps After a Positive
A positive result on a high-sensitivity test is a powerful indicator of pregnancy. Here's what to consider next.
- Contact Your Healthcare Provider: Schedule an appointment to confirm the pregnancy. They will likely do a blood test, which can measure the exact quantity of hCG (a beta hCG test), providing more information than a qualitative urine test.
- Begin or Continue Prenatal Vitamins: If you aren't already taking them, start immediately. Folic acid is critically important in the very early stages of neural tube development.
- Adjust Lifestyle Habits: Avoid alcohol, recreational drugs, and limit caffeine. Discuss any prescription medications you are taking with your doctor to ensure they are safe during pregnancy.
- Practice Self-Care: The early weeks of pregnancy can be physically and emotionally taxing. Listen to your body, rest when you need to, and lean on your support system.
